Abstract

The invention relates to an evaporative cooling unit and a descaling control method and device of the evaporative cooling unit. The method comprises the steps that a detection result of circulating cooling water is obtained; a cyclic decoupling and coupling judgment result of a heat exchanger is generated according to the detection result; and when it is determined that the scale prevention mode starting condition is met according to the cyclic decoupling and coupling judgment result, a guide rail and / or a pollution discharge device of the evaporative cooling unit are / is controlled to conductdescaling operation. Through the adoption of the method, in different actual application scenes, the guide rail or the pollution discharge device is used for carrying out descaling treatment on the evaporative cooling unit in time, the operation that workers manually use a descaling tool to carry out descaling is not needed, the descaling treatment efficiency is improved, and unit dirt can be effectively removed.

technical field [0001] The present application relates to the technical field of electrical control, in particular to an evaporative cooling unit and a descaling control method and device for the evaporative cooling unit. Background technique [0002] With the development of electrical control technology and the wide application of evaporative cooling units in different electrical equipment with refrigeration needs, in order to ensure the long-term normal operation of electrical equipment, the scaling problem of evaporative cooling units has been paid more and more attention. [0003] Aiming at the fouling problem of the unit, traditionally, the circulating cooling water is softened, or the method of regular manual cleaning is adopted.
